Output e4f34dcb0271e81a9c711ee96adbab9e0503d918bcb28d8d0586814c78cb169b:4

value
51914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c2a0e5d58c2432025e341985c0b3dbfd2f8391 OP_EQUAL
address
3QjVMun3qUssTzHJp1UA7vVfj6MWeWkABd
transaction
e4f34dcb0271e81a9c711ee96adbab9e0503d918bcb28d8d0586814c78cb169b
confirmations
184473
spent
true